Little Bennies drive-in, on Trent Ave in Spokane Washington, hosted their first cruise night of the season. After the winter and cold spring we've had up here, there is a lot of pent-up need for fun in the sun. Even RBI fabricator, Gregg D. showed up in his Pontiac.It was also owner Zeke Sawyer's last day. He sold the business last month. Zeke and family have owned and operated burger places in the Spokane Valley for over 30 years. He says now he's going to work on his '69 Chevelle and play the drums more. As for the new owners, we wish them continued success. Hope they like old cars.
We are Rod Builders Inc, a custom vehicle design and fabrication shop in Spokane, WA. We can do just about anything you need done on your collectible car. We specialize in sheet metal fabrication and designing complicated mechanisms. We do engine transplants, assembly, wiring, and plumbing. We also do complete restorations and tricky upholstery projects. We don't spread mud or do paint, but we know people in Spokane who can.
